What Does AEO Actually Look Like for a Financial Advisory Practice?

AEO is not a single tactic. It’s a system of content, technical structure, and authority signals that work together to make your website the go-to source for financial questions in your market.

Structured Content That Answers Real Questions

AI tools pull answers from pages that are clearly organized, directly answer a specific question in the first paragraph, and use language that mirrors how real people ask questions. Instead of writing a generic “About Our Services” page, an AEO-optimized site features content like “What’s the minimum to work with a financial advisor in Jersey City?” or “How does fee-only financial planning work?” — answered concisely and completely.

Schema Markup and Technical Signals

Schema markup tells search engines and AI crawlers exactly what your content means. For financial advisors, that includes FAQPage schema, LocalBusiness schema with your Hudson County address, and ProfessionalService schema. Without this layer, even well-written content gets overlooked in favor of competitors who have done the technical work.

E-E-A-T: Experience, Expertise, Authoritativeness, Trust

Google’s quality raters and AI systems both weight E-E-A-T heavily for financial topics — classified as “Your Money or Your Life” content. Your site needs author bios that reference real credentials (CFP, CFA, RIA registration), client testimonials where permitted by FINRA guidelines, and consistent NAP (name, address, phone) data across every directory. Jersey City advisors who ignore E-E-A-T signals lose ground to firms that actively build them.

How AEO Compares to Traditional SEO for Financial Advisors

Traditional SEO gets you ranked. AEO gets you cited. Both matter, but they serve different stages of the search journey.

With standard SEO, you optimize for keywords, earn backlinks, and hope a user clicks your blue link. With AEO, you structure your content so that an AI assistant reads your page and presents your answer directly to a user who may never visit your site at all — but who calls your office because the AI told them you’re the local expert. That’s a warmer lead with higher intent.

For financial advisors, the combination is powerful. You want to rank for “fee-only financial advisor Jersey City” in traditional results AND be the source cited when someone asks Google’s AI overview that same question. These aren’t mutually exclusive goals — they share much of the same foundation — but AEO requires an additional layer of intentional content architecture that most advisory websites simply don’t have yet.

Frequently Asked Questions: AEO for Financial Advisors in Jersey City

What is AEO and why does it matter for Jersey City financial advisors?

AEO stands for Answer Engine Optimization. It’s the process of structuring your website content so that AI tools, voice assistants, and Google’s featured snippets present your firm as the authoritative answer to financial questions. In Jersey City’s competitive financial services market, AEO helps advisors earn visibility even when users never click a traditional search result.

How is AEO different from SEO?

SEO focuses on ranking your pages in traditional search results. AEO goes a step further by formatting content so AI-powered tools cite your firm directly in their generated answers. For financial advisors, both are valuable — SEO drives clicks, while AEO builds authority and earns zero-click visibility with high-intent prospects.

How long does it take to see AEO results for a financial advisory firm?

Most firms begin seeing measurable improvements in featured snippet and AI overview visibility within 60 to 90 days of implementing structured content and schema markup. Building sustained authority in competitive markets like Hudson County typically takes three to six months of consistent effort.

Does AEO comply with FINRA and SEC marketing rules for financial advisors?

Yes. AEO tactics — structured content, schema markup, FAQ pages, and local optimization — are marketing channels subject to the same compliance review as any other digital content. Mint Marketing works within your compliance framework, and all content is structured for approval before publication.

What local signals matter most for AEO in Jersey City?

The most impactful local signals include a fully optimized Google Business Profile with a Hudson County address, NAP consistency across directories, neighborhood-specific content referencing areas like Journal Square, the Heights, and Downtown Jersey City, and locally relevant FAQ content that mirrors how Jersey City residents actually phrase their financial questions.

Can AEO help me compete with larger Manhattan-based firms?

Yes. AI tools and local search algorithms favor specificity and local relevance. A well-structured Jersey City advisory site with clear local signals and concise answers to hyper-local financial questions will often outperform a large Manhattan firm’s generic content in local and regional AI-driven results.
